Core Differences Between Cast AI and Scaleops

Core Differences Between Tools

When you start digging into the guts of these tools, you notice the philosophy shift quickly. Cast AI is built to take over.

If you give it the keys, it will replace your existing node groups and swap them for the most cost-efficient instances it can find, often in real-time.

Scaleops feels less like a replacement and more like a layer on top of your existing setup. It helps you optimize what is already there.

I found the onboarding for Scaleops to be much friendlier. It felt like I was tuning a car I already owned, whereas Cast AI felt like someone came in, took my car, and replaced it with a more fuel-efficient model I had to learn how to drive.

The support experiences were also distinct. Cast AI has a more enterprise-grade, support-ticket heavy culture. Scaleops felt like chatting with engineers who actually built the product.

Understanding Cast AI’s Offerings & Exact Pricing

Cast AI is not shy about their value proposition. They usually operate on a percentage of savings model.

This is a clever move. If they do not save you money, you do not pay them.

Current pricing usually starts around 10% to 15% of the savings generated, though they have enterprise plans for massive clusters.

You are essentially paying a commission on their efficiency.

It is best for startups scaling rapidly where nodes are being spun up and down constantly and you just do not have the time to track it.

The standout feature here is their ability to perform automated spot instance migration.

Most tools are too scared to touch spot instances because of the risk of interruption. Cast AI manages it with such speed that it barely matters.

Who is Scaleops & What is Their Pricing?

Scaleops entered the market because they saw that developers were tired of black-box automation that breaks things.

They wanted to build a platform that provides the same level of optimization but with more “human-in-the-loop” visibility.

Their pricing model is usually more predictable, often based on a flat monthly fee per node or based on total cloud spend.

It is very attractive to Series B or C companies that need to predict their software costs for budget forecasting.

What Makes Scaleops Stand Out

The UX is where they win me over. The dashboard actually shows you *why* a suggestion was made.

I remember one afternoon looking at a cluster that was constantly over-provisioned. Scaleops gave me a clear recommendation: “Reduce memory request by 15% to save $400/month.”

I could verify the data, click “Approve,” and the change happened instantly. It felt controlled, safe, and incredibly satisfying.

Benefits and Real Experiences with Cast AI

I have to be honest: Cast AI is a beast. The amount of money it saved on my test clusters was truly staggering.

However, there were moments of pure frustration. I had a deployment where the autoscaler misjudged the startup time of a heavy Java microservice, and for about thirty seconds, my traffic was hitting an empty node group.

That is the price you pay for extreme automation. You save money, but you sacrifice a bit of peace of mind.
